FINANCIAL AID COORDINATOR
Arizona State University is a leading educational institution seeking a Financial Aid Coordinator to support students at the Sandra Day O'Connor College of Law. The role involves providing financial aid advising, compliance, and reporting while collaborating closely with admissions and financial aid staff.

Responsibilities
Participates in the planning, goal setting, and evaluation of the financial aid process and operations
Effectively communicates information about financial aid and the College of Law to prospective, incoming, and enrolled students across all degree programs at the law school, including delivering presentations to groups, holding individual advising appointments, presenting at information sessions and panels, and maintaining student-facing information and resources
Manages a high volume of student inquiries and counseling sessions, and provides a high level of individualized support to students
Provides counseling and advising about financial aid opportunities, eligibility, and procedures via email, telephone, video/Zoom, in person, and through social media platforms
Supports collecting and analyzing financial data to determine aid eligibility, make awards within federal, donor and/or institutional guidelines, and track requirements
Interfaces with lenders, employers, donors, guarantee agencies and/or staff to communicate required information and resolve issues
Help coordinate the administration of financial aid programs and reporting
Assists with office administrative duties, including front desk coverage, answering phones, responding to emails, document upload, and other tasks for both admissions and financial aid
Works closely with the FASS and Director of Financial Aid to ensure high quality and accountability in all work, attend meetings and trainings to stay updated on developments, and interpret federal regulations, guidelines, pending legislation and professional literature on financial aid
Maintains scholarship database for the law school and works closely with the law school development team to ensure that all scholarships are properly administered and help manage law school scholarship accounts
Uses professional judgment in assessing financial aid needs and makes adjustments to individual student aid accounts accordingly
Administers short-term loan funds as needed for law students
Physical presence at the College of Law is an essential function or requirement of this job
Performs other duties as assigned that benefit goals of the department
Qualification
Required
Associate's degree and one (1) year of experience appropriate to the area of assignment/field; OR, Any equivalent combination of experience and/or training from which comparable knowledge, skills and abilities have been achieved
Preferred
Demonstrated knowledge of ASU and ASU Sandra Day O'Connor College of Law
Demonstrated knowledge of financial aid policies and procedures
Experience in financial aid counseling
Experience working with a wide range of constituencies
Experience working with graduate and professional students
Experience giving presentations about financial aid; demonstrated written and public speaking skills
Experience with financial aid systems; high technological proficiency
Experience sharing financial aid content
